A manufacturer claims his light bulbs have a mean life of 1500 hours. A consumer group wants to test if their light bulbs do not last as long as the manufacturer claims. They tested a random sample of 220 bulbs and found them to have a sample mean life of 1490 hours and a sample standard deviation of 40 hours. Assess the manufacturer's claim.

Answer #1

a) μ = 1500

b) μ < 1500

c)test statistic =(1490-1500)*sqrt(220)/40= -3.708

d) P ≤ .01

e)Yes
